- Liberian Lawmakers Mediate Dispute Between UMC and Global Methodist Churchon 03/23/2025 at 1:33 PM
The United Methodist Church (UMC) and the Global Methodist Church (GMC) are currently facing significant disputes over control of church properties in West Africa, prompting Liberian lawmakers to mediate between the two denominations. Earlier this month, the Liberian Senate held an official hearing that brought representatives from both bodies together, overseen by the Joint Senate Committee.

- Idaho Enacts Law Protecting Medical Professionals' Conscience Rightson 03/21/2025 at 11:47 AM
Idaho has enacted a new law aimed at protecting healthcare providers from being required to perform or participate in procedures that conflict with their beliefs. Republican Governor Brad Little signed House Bill 59, known as the Medical Ethics Defense Act, into law on Wednesday. The legislation passed with a 58-11 vote in the Republican-controlled Idaho House of Representatives and a 28-6 vote in the Republican-controlled Idaho Senate.
